If you're looking to connect creative execution with high-level strategy or if you've received an ultimatum from your part-time teaching position to get your Master's Degree for CHED compliance, this article might just be what you need. Based on our team's research, we’ve compiled a list of top schools for those interested in pursuing a graduate degree in Design, Animation, and Multimedia.

Master of Computer Graphics and Animation (MCGA) Ateneo de Naga University
Location: Naga City, Camarines Sur (Main Campus)
Modality: Hybrid / Distance Learning Available
(Fully remote options available for remote students/practitioners)
Price per semester: ₱13,000 – ₱15,000
(Approx. ₱26,000 – ₱30,000/year)
For those seeking excellence in digital storytelling and production expertise, ADNU’s MCGA program is a standout choice. Offered by their esteemed College of Computer Studies, this program seamlessly combines technical computer science with artistic expression.
The curriculum is focused on production while being anchored in academic research. Students engage in advanced 3D and 2D animation, story development, digital sculpture, and contemporary arts theory. Additionally, technical creatives can explore specialized electives in game programming, physics modeling, and augmented reality techniques, making this program an ideal launchpad for the next generation of creative directors, animation producers, and design mentors in the country.

Master of Digital Media (MDM)
De La Salle-College of Saint Benilde
Location: Malate, Manila
Modality: Blended Learning
(On-campus requirements mixed with synchronous online sessions)
Price per semester: ₱45,000 – ₱65,000
(Varies based on unit load and specific laboratory/software access fees)
This program is tailored for professionals eager to step into creative leadership or mentorship roles. The interdisciplinary approach emphasizes navigating emerging technologies, digital branding, advanced photography, and interactive web design within a practical, real-world context.

Master of Arts in Multimedia Arts
& PhD in Multimedia Arts
Mapúa University
Location: Makati City / Manila
Modality: UOx (Fully Online Tracks Available)
(Asynchronous & synchronous distance options via their digital portal)
Price per semester: ₱35,000 – ₱50,000
(Mapúa runs on a Quarterm system; this range reflects the normalized cost per semester)
If your goal is to engage in industry research or delve into academic theory, Mapúa offers a well-structured MA in Multimedia Arts that focuses on advanced concept design and video production. Importantly, Mapúa also provides a Doctor of Philosophy (PhD) in Multimedia Arts, which explores global multimedia theories, data visualization, and the scholarly study of new media.

Master/MS in Innovation
Through Media Arts Technology
Ateneo de Manila University
Location: Quezon City
Modality: Face-to-Face & Hybrid
Price per semester: ₱60,000 – ₱85,000
(Based on post-grad unit rates and advanced tech infrastructure fees)
Ateneo presents two tracks: MIMAT for professional practice and MS IMAT for intensive research. This innovative program trains students to create new experiences and technological solutions by merging core programming principles with design thinking, media arts, and hands-on, project-based prototyping.
